Please note that SDM below refers to both SDM and DC.
Be aware that some lenses are SDM only (e.g. DA17-70, your DA18-135 as far as I know) and don't have screw drive; they will become manual focus lenses on (older) cameras that don't support SDM (e.g. K100D).
Also, you can't fall back on screw drive in case SDM (in the lens) fails, even if the lens supports SDM and screw drive. As long as the camera that supports SDM detects a lens with a motor in it, it will insist on using SDM and not screw drive.
